Platelet Rich Plasma (PRP)

Autologous (patient's own) blood is processed (centrifuged) to separate and form Platelet Rich Plasma. PRP contains various growth factors and cytokines which are useful for healing and regenerative processes such as facial rejuvenation, male and female pattern hair loss, acne scars, post traumatic atrophic scars, wound healing (ulcers), hyperpigmentary conditions (melasma, undereye dark circles).

Cryosurgery

Local freezing of tissue (-20°C to -196°C) is carried out with cryogens (freezing substances) such as Carbon Dioxide Snow and Liquid Nitrogen to treat warts, molluscum contagiosum severe acne and its scars, keloids, leukoplakia, actinic keratosis and to destroy early lesions of skin malignancies.

Mesotherapy

Minute dosages of nutrients (vitamins, minerals, amino acids, plant extracts), enzymes and hormones are introduced into the affected areas either manually (micro-injections) or by mesoguns. It is used for facial rejuvenation, (mesoglow), skin tightening (mesolift), hair loss (male and female pattern alopecia), hyperpigmentation (melasma, undereye dark circles) and to treat localized excess fat deposits and cellulite.

Keloid & Hypertrophic Scars

These are extra tissue growths which are commonly seen after traumatic/ surgical wounding or may follow ear-piercing / idiopathic (keliod only). They are painful, itchy & may get secondarily infected at high recurrence rate. They not only cause cosmetic disfigurement but may also lead to contractures & limb immobility. Surgical modalities include combination techniques such as debulking of tissue with scalpel, Radiofrequency, Liquid Nitrogen Cryosurgery, Laser along with Intralesional injections & silicone pressure dressing / garment.

Hair Transplant

Hair restoration surgeries such as Follicular Unit Transplant (FUT) and Follicular Unit Extraction (FUE) using patients own hair from scalp or other body parts are carried out using 1500 to 3000 micrografts (single/multiple/mega sessions) for treating male and female patterned hairloss (common baldness) and cicatricial (scarring) alopecia. FUE is also used for cosmetic correction of leukotrichia (white hair) of eyebrow and eyelashes in vitiligo.

Sclerotherapy

Direct injection of small amount of an irritating solution into the abnormally dilated blood vessel followed by immediate application of compression to maintain contact of intravascular solution of endothelial cells. Indication are superficial telangiectasias, venulectasias of lower limb, hemangiomas, venous malformation.
